Valius Ying was a Twi'lek pirate and bounty hunter operating out of Taris during the time of the Mandalorian Wars. His ship was the Oroko and he was a known associate of Marn Hierogryph.

Biography
Edit

Ying once hired the Moomo Brothers, but fired them due to their incompetence. He later took up the bounty on Zayne Carrick after the Padawan Massacre of Taris, it was Ying who finally captured him and his group of friends. Though there was also a sizable bounty on Gryph's head, the crimelord was able to negotiate giving the access codes to his Tari warehouses to Ying in exchange let him and the rest of his friends go, settling with the large bounty on Carrick's head. Upon delivering Carrick into the hands of Lucien Draay and the other Jedi Masters, Ying was unwillingly forced to listen to the true account of the deaths of the Padawans. After Ying had heard all of the details, Draay drew his lightsaber and killed the bounty hunter instantly.
Behind the scenes
Edit
- "For Valius' design, I suggested to Travel Foreman and Brian Ching that we come up with an alien Tony Soprano—a gangleader who's somewhat full of himself and only later realizes he's in over his head."
- ―John Jackson Miller
Valius Ying was created by John Jackson Miller, the writer of the Star Wars: Knights of the Old Republic comic series. He was drawn by Harvey Tolibao in the fifth issue of the Commencement story arc. Ying was drawn by Brian Ching in the arc's sixth issue.
